Position Summary
The Information Technology Division (ITD) Project and Billing Support Coordinator reports to the IT Network and Infrastructure Operations Lead and the Director of ITNI. This role plays a crucial part in the successful execution of the Zoom Phone migration project. Key responsibilities include supporting the IT Division in all aspects of the Zoom Phone migration, including billing, communications, customer coordination, data entry, and other necessary tasks. Additionally, the coordinator assists with the closeout of ITNI billing orders and reviews and updates data needed for the Zoom Phone transition. They will also collaborate with the ITFA Billing Team to migrate data to the new campus billing system.
This role requires str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and effective communication. By contributing to this critical project, you'll help enhance our communication infrastructure and improve overall efficiency.
This is a part-time (.75 time-base), benefits eligible, temporary position anticipated to end one year from the start date with the possibility of reappointment for an additional year. This position is designated non-exempt under FLSA and is eligible for overtime compensation. Standard SDSU work hours are Monday - Friday, 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m., but may vary based on operational needs.
The individual hired into this role will work on campus at SDSU in San Diego.
Department Summary
The purpose of the Information Technology Division (ITD) is to provide the technology that empowers SDSU's success. The IT Division includes several departments and areas with the shared mission to leverage people and technology to support SDSU's commitment to innovative teaching, research, and service. The IT Division is led by the Chief Information Officer, who is ultimately responsible for developing the long-term infrastructure, services, and strategy necessary to support the University's mission of learning, discovery, and engagement. The IT Division has the stewardship responsibility for core IT assets on campus and the obligation to provide the services, training, and community building necessary to realize the benefits of those investments across the San Diego State University community. The IT Division is made up of 185 staff and 28 administrators.
IT Network Infrastructure (ITNI) is responsible for providing network infrastructure to support the university's IT needs. ITNI supports the campus networks and Internet access, including all wired and wireless networking. ITNI provides campus telephone service for faculty and staff, including voice mail, call centers, and other voice services. We install and support campus fiber and copper cable infrastructure for all campus buildings. ITNI supports these services on the main campus, residence halls, IV-Calexico, IV-Brawley, and off-site foundation buildings.
